Try to grow a plate with nothing on it. If something grows, it's not sterile.
Sterility can be confirmed by observing the media for absence of microbial growth after incubation, checking for turbidity or cloudiness in the media, and ensuring there is no foul smell. Additionally, using aseptic techniques during media preparation and handling can help ensure sterility. A positive control can also be included to verify that the media is capable of supporting microbial growth.
